Re: Yamaha RM1X / Korg EM1 - Experiences?

I you want an electribe, check out the emx-1 it's a lot better than the em-1!
Way back I had the es-1 sampler and it sounded cool. lofi in a good way

Re: Yamaha RM1X / Korg EM1 - Experiences?

the rm1x sounds really outdated and has crappy samples but a good sequencer (but for some reason you cant switch between write and play in rec so for live its just so so...), em1 is realy basic but does sound better. it has a very electriby rompler sound.

Re: Buying a new PC

Yeah, but you also need a fan, a case, hard drives, windows etc. But 1000 should be doable. Get the best cpu you can afford, you don't really need a graphics card. check what connections there are and what you need on the motherboard. Get a silent fan, ditch the stock one because it's small and noisy.
